Exhibition and book published by Gallimard of Ils furent foule soudain, by the photographers from the MYOP photo agency.
“They were only a few, they were suddenly a crowd”: it is on these verses by Paul Éluard that Amnesty International and the MYOP agency meet to bear witness together to the power of the demonstrations.
From the historic Tiananmen Square protests in China to the youth climate strikes and the Arab Spring uprisings, this exhibition immerses you in the momentum of collective mobilizations, driven by a combination of gestures. Those of the protesters on one side and those of the photographers on the other, who ultimately become one, to deliver the same story.
The people who protest are as convinced that they are in their place, here – to make demands – as the photographers are convinced that they are in their place, there – to document, inform, tell.
If we tend to want to denounce what shocks us, displeases us, astounds us or makes us angry, it is by demonstrating that individual demands become collective demands. Demonstrating motivates us. Demonstrating commits us. It is an irrepressible reflex: a universal act of resistance and solidarity. The right to demonstrate peacefully must be exercised without hindrance. However, it is too often contested and repressed.
Because it is essential and because it protects others, it must constantly be defended.
The exhibition is visible on rue de Rivoli and in the inner courtyard of the Académie du Climat, from March 14th to May 11th, 2025.

” Ils furent foule soudain “ is also a book, published in the Hoëbeke collection by Gallimard, with texts by Alaa El-Aswany and a preface by Salomé Saqué.
